Authentic Korean Kimchi Jjigae Recipe

A vibrant bowl of Korean Kimchi Jjigae with pork and tofu, garnished with green onions, served with rice on a traditional Korean table.

This kimchi soup is a delightfully spicy and tangy dish that combines aged kimchi with tender meat, tofu, and vegetables. It’s robust, flavorful, and perfect for serving hot with a side of rice.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ups well-fermented kimchi, chopped
  • 1/2 pound pork belly or tofu, diced
  • 1 medium onion, sliced
  • 2 green onions,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on gochugaru (Korean red pepper flakes)
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 4 cups water or broth
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 1 block of firm tofu, diced
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Ingredients: Chop the kimchi, dice the pork belly or tofu, and slice the onion and green onions.
  2. Sauté Kimchi: In a pot, heat sesame oil over medium heat and add the kimchi. Sauté for about 5 minutes until fragrant.
  3. Add Pork: Add the diced pork belly and cook until browned. If using tofu, add it later.
  4. Combine Ingredients: Stir in the onion, gochugaru, and soy sauce. Pour in the water or broth, and bring to a boil.
  5. Simmer: Reduce the heat and let the soup simmer for about 15 minutes.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per as needed.
  6. Add Tofu: Gently stir in the diced tofu and simmer for an additional 5 minutes.
  7. Serve: Garnish with chopped green onions and serve hot with steamed rice.

Cook and Prep Times

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 30 minutes
  • Total Time: 40 minutes
